How does the accounting services calculator work?
The calculator uses the same rate grid as our accounting price list. You enter the legal form (sole proprietor JDG or company), VAT status, the monthly number of documents and the number of employees — the system then assigns the matching price tier and shows an estimated amount. The tool is useful when you plan the company budget or compare offers while switching accounting firms: in a few minutes you see the indicative cost, without calling anyone or waiting for a quote.
The accounting price calculator step by step
Filling in the calculator takes a few minutes. Below we show, step by step, which data are worth entering so that the result is as close as possible to the actual price.
Choose the legal form of your business
First, define the legal form of your company. It can be a sole proprietorship (JDG), a civil-law partnership or a limited liability company (sp. z o.o.). Each of these forms has its own accounting requirements, which directly affect the service fee.
Define your VAT status
Next, indicate whether your company is a VAT payer. Companies registered for VAT require additional work — preparing VAT returns and keeping the registers — which has a noticeable impact on the price.
Enter the number of documents
At this step, enter the monthly number of all bookings: sales invoices, purchase invoices, credit notes, insurance policies, tickets, netting statements, bank statements, cash reports, payroll runs and DRA declarations to ZUS. The higher the number of documents, the higher the price.
Define the number of employees
Enter the number of employees (excluding the owner). HR and payroll service is a separate scope of work which noticeably affects the final estimate.

Accounting prices — what do they depend on?
A few specific factors affect the price. Form of accounting: the lump-sum tax on recorded revenue is usually the cheapest, KPiR is somewhat more expensive, and full accounting — mandatory for companies — is the most expensive, because it requires the most work. Number of documents: the base price covers a set monthly limit, and each additional document is charged separately — that's why organising the document flow really reduces the bill. Number of employees: every employee means additional HR and payroll work, which we add to the price. VAT status: VAT-registered companies need registers, returns and JPK files, which also increases the cost of service. Frequently asked questions (FAQ) about the accounting price calculator
Answers to the questions that come up most often when using the calculator.
What happens to unused document limits at the end of the month?
Unused limits do not carry over to the next month. Accounting service is settled on a monthly basis, so every month is treated separately.
How does the fee work for months with no documents to record?
If there are no documents to record but the business is active, the basic subscription fee applies — regardless of the number of documents.
What information is needed to get an accurate accounting quote?
No documents are required for an initial quote. It's enough to fill in the calculator form, providing among others the legal form, the number of documents and the number of employees.
